What is FOCN?

Fiber Optic Communication Network (FOCN) is a system for transferring digital signals over optical fibers using light pulses. The main advantage of this system is that it provides significantly higher transfer speeds than traditional copper wiring solutions, allowing for greater data throughputs at longer distances without suffering from the same signal loss experienced when using copper cables. Moreover, fiber optic systems are much more reliable due to their physically secure nature; since they are not liable to electrical interference or corrosion, they can operate without being affected by external sources as compared to their metallic counterparts.

What is fiber optic communications?

Fiber optic communications is a type of technology that uses optical fibers to transmit digital data signals over long distances. This method offers numerous benefits compared to other forms of communication, such as increased bandwidth and resistance to electromagnetic interference (EMI).

How does fiber optic communication work?

Fiber optic communication works by using light pulses to quickly transfer information along an optical fiber. When light passes through the core of the optical fiber, it can be reflected and transmitted with very little loss in signal strength or quality.

Is there difference between single-mode vs multimode FOCN?

Yes, there is a difference between single-mode vs multimode operation when working with FOCN technology; specifically, single-mode supports longer distances while multimode supports shorter distances but higher speeds.

Is FOCN expensive compared to traditional networks?

Generally speaking, costs associated with implementing a fiber optics communications network are more expensive than traditional networks like copper wire systems; however, since they offer better performance and reliability at higher speeds over greater distances these costs may ultimately provide greater savings in the long run due to lowered operating costs and fewer maintenance needs.

Does fiber optics require additional equipment at either end of its connection?

Yes, some form of transceiver needs to be installed into each connected device in order to convert the optical signals into electrical signals so they can be decoded properly by the receiving devices. These transceivers range from small plug-in modules up to more complex rackmounted systems depending on the specific application requirements.
